The ''[[Imponte]]'' '''Ruiner''' is a 2-door coupe found exclusively in [[Grand Theft Auto IV]], resembling a 1982–1992 Pontiac Firebird, and even more a third generation [http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Chevrolet_Camaro Chevrolet Camaro], some even featuring a "Ruiner" decal along the lower part of the doors, similar to the Camaro's IROC-Z counterpart.

The curved rear windscreen is unmistakable as GM's F-Body sports car range. However, the front-end semi-concealed pop-up headlights are more reminiscent of the 1984-1986 Nissan 300ZX (Z31 Series) but the nose seems slightly smoothed—much like the Camaro's. There are also a couple Pontiac Firebird influences: The taillights are shaped like a Camaro's, but the arrangement of the lights looks similar to a Firebird's and the area between the taillights is similar to a Firebird's (but says "Imponte" where the Firebird logo would be). It is likely meant to emulate a Firebird since it is manufactured by Imponte but it bears a closer appearance to a Camaro.


Ruiners feature license plate frames that say "Ruining Imports Since '67," which is the year the aforementioned GM F-body coupes debuted (however, this seems contradicted since it has some Nissan influence).

==Variant==

There is a special gold-colored edition version of the Ruiner that has a gold-on-gold paint finish, and gold rims.  It can be found parked, or in traffic.
